Kleiva
Kleiva is a hamlet in Stjørdal Municipality, Trøndelag. Kleiva is situated nearby to the hamlet Skjelstadmarka, as well as near the locality Leirbakken.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Fættenfjorden
Locality
Fættenfjorden is a small fjord that branches off of the Trondheimsfjord northeast of the city of Trondheim in Trøndelag county, Norway. The fjord is located on the border of Stjørdal Municipality and Levanger Municipality. Fættenfjorden is situated 9 km northwest of Kleiva.
